Common Foundation Structural Repair Jobs
Foundation stabilization - techniques to prevent further settling or shifting of the building.
Crack repair - sealing and reinforcing cracks to restore structural integrity.
Pier and beam foundation repair - addressing issues specific to homes built on piers or beams.
Concrete lifting and leveling - raising sunken slabs to their original position for safety and appearance.
Drainage correction - improving water flow away from the foundation to prevent future damage.
Soil stabilization - reinforcing soil around the foundation to reduce shifting and settling.
Foundation Structural Repair Questions
What causes foundation issues in homes? Foundation problems can result from soil movement, poor drainage, or settling over time, affecting stability.
How can I tell if my foundation needs repair? Signs include cracks in walls or floors, uneven floors, or gaps around windows and doors.
What types of foundation repairs are common? Common methods include underpinning, wall stabilization, and slab leveling to restore stability.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air, but significant or expanding cracks should be evaluated by a professional.
